Summary

IP9 1FA is a residential postcode in Harkstead, Suffolk. It was first introduced in April 2016.

The most common council tax bands are C and B.

Residential buildings are primarily terraced (including end-terrace). Domestic properties are primarily bungalows.

Most residential buildings are of unknown age.

Domestic properties are predominantly owner occupied.

The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ating is C.

IP9 1FA is in the Ipswich trav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Suffolk Primary Care Trust.
